Q: Is 378,504 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 378,504 is a composite number.

Why is 378,504 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 378,504 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 7 8 9 12 14 18 21 24 28 36 42 56 63 72 84 126 168 252 504 751 1,502 2,253 3,004 4,506 5,257 6,008 6,759 9,012 10,514 13,518 15,771 18,024 21,028 27,036 31,542 42,056 47,313 54,072 63,084 94,626 126,168 189,252 and 378,504, with no remainder.

Since 378,504 cannot be divided by just 1 and 378,504, it is a composite number.
